It is noticeable that the two European bus models (Neoplan Centroliner and Mercedes Benz Citaro) shown in this website are articulated buses. As I know, NONE of the Japanese bus manufacturers produce articulated bus chassis, so they could only be imported from other countries.原帖由 abh 於 2011-9-22 20:37 發表 http://www.hkitalk.net/HKiTalk2/images/common/back.gif
